WebJan 31, 2024 · Cooking time will vary somewhat, depending on your oven, the size of your loaf pan, and whether you have other food baking in the oven at the same time as your meatloaf. I set my oven for 350°F and it usually takes about 90 minutes for the internal temperature of the meatloaf to reach 165°F. It also helps to bind the meat together with the egg so that it molds well. Bread crumbs are used in meatloaf to keep the meatloaf meat oils suspended in the loaf and not run out of the loaf into the pan leaving the meat dry.

Stuffing, filling, or dressing is an edible mixture, often composed of herbs and a starch such as bread, used to fill a cavity in the preparation of another food item.
